Barista recommended peanut latte as their signature drink, it’s nutty with strong aroma,taste is - stronger than normal Americans cafe latte. Winner is the cake I had. Was attracted to its look and true, it taste quite good. First bite - kind of sweet but, after you took 2nd, 3rd, 4th bites, you’ll find the sweetness starting to disappear and feel more n more satisfying. Even when coming to last bite size, the cake still stands well. It looks classy just like the vibes in the cafe, a place for well mannered adults of all ages. Food: 3 Service: 5 Atmosphere: 5

Train station café in Seoul?! @nakwonst Welcome to @nakwonst in Seoul — where adorable little trains literally showcase the dessert lineup like a display straight out of a K-drama scene. I tried their Green Grass Matcha Cheesecake and WOW it was so rich, creamy, and packed with deep matcha flavour. Not too sweet, just perfectly balanced and insanely satisfying. And to refresh? The Raspberry Ade was the perfect combo of fruity + fizzy — light, refreshing, and so pretty! This place is honestly made for slow mornings and calm afternoons. The garden area is especially peaceful it feels like you’ve escaped the busy Seoul streets for a moment The staff were also super warm and welcoming, which made the whole experience even better. Food: 5 Service: 5 Atmosphere: 5
